Mild and sweet, Roland Foods Whole Red Piquillo Peppers are lightly grilled before canning to lock in their bright flavor. These whole grilled red peppers have thick walls and triangular shape that has earned them the name “piquillo,” or “little beak.” Because of these qualities, piquillo red peppers are ideally suited for stuffing with cheese or meat and baking, but can also be used in any application one would generally use bell peppers. They deliver a slightly sweet and tangy flavor complemented by a touch of smoke from the grill, adding a rich flavor profile to hot or cold appetizer, antipasto, and tapas dishes.
